These Polks replaced a pair of RCAs with 12" woofers. Big deep bass was not expected out of them-that's what subwoofers are for. I have a powered sub and did not need those huge speakers anymore. My setup is stereo, not surround sound or home theater-receiver is just 2 channels and puts out 75 watts/channel.. I was worried about them not having enough mid bass, but there's nothing to worry about at all. They have almost as much as the big monsters they replaced! The mids and highs sound great. Right now they're sitting on top of the other speakers about 3 feet above the ground. I can't wait until I get some brackets to hang them on the wall-probably sound even better. Some bookshelf speakers are very pricey-several hundred dollars. But these sound great at this entry level price point. Later I'll get another pair to replace the Pioneers with 8" woofers, hang all of them on the wall, and have more space in this cluttered room.

I bought this unit to replace a dead DVD player and dying VCR. It's nice to get both in one package-and at one low price. The picture quality on VHS and DVD are good. It's easy to operate-didn't even open the instruction book. There is an extra set of front input jacks to easily hook up a camcorder, playstation, or something else. I can't comment on recording-I don't record in the room it's in. Keep in mind there's no built in tuner. But that shouldn't be a problem for most because most cable and satellite boxes have the RCA output jacks.
